Output 3044095dd6e8bbf1b78fd19be44856f3ee2493671f5982fe4314b73017911803:1

value
1018600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daead7375bce45ff0a798c00086d73657f43ddbd OP_EQUAL
address
MTrgsGQ7v3gpaZE8TwMPp9v27NRsvMvaY8
transaction
3044095dd6e8bbf1b78fd19be44856f3ee2493671f5982fe4314b73017911803
spent
true